The 50/30/20 Rule: A Simple yet Effective Budgeting Framework

When it comes to budgeting, there's no one-size-fits-all approach. However, I'd like to introduce you to a simple yet effective framework that has been widely adopted by financial experts and individuals alike – the 50/30/20 rule.

This rule is straightforward: allocate 50% of your income towards necessary expenses such as rent, utilities, and groceries; use 30% for discretionary spending like entertainment and hobbies; and dedicate 20% to saving and debt repayment.

By following this framework, you'll be able to strike a balance between enjoying the present moment and securing your financial future.

Overcoming Financial Fears and Building a Safety Net

It's natural to feel anxious about your financial situation, especially if you're struggling to make ends meet. But the truth is, building a safety net can be incredibly empowering.

By setting aside a small portion of your income each month, you'll be better equipped to handle unexpected expenses and avoid going into debt.

Remember, it's not about depriving yourself of things you enjoy; it's about making conscious choices that align with your values and goals.
